摘要
Edge-domain wall controls the switching behaviour in ultra-thin films and understanding them is of fundamental importance. The edge domains in an anti-parallel coupled bilayer magnetic him can be well reproduced by the analytic exact two-solition solution of the imaginary time Sine-Gordon equation. For a single-layer film, the domain pattern deviates slightly from the two-soliton equation because of uncompensated magnetic charges near the corners and at the domain walls. As the number of the layers is increased and switches between even and odd, the domain pattern also switches between these two limits. The deviation from the two soliton solution becomes smaller because the net uncompensated magnetic charge per unit layer decreases. (C) 1998 Elsevier Science B.V. All rights reserved.
